
Today we are happy to have California Assemblymember Sharon Quirk-Silva who represents the 65th Assembly District, which includes portions of northern Orange County. She talked about helping to open up Disneyland and Knotts Berry Farm, and the opening up of the economy in her district. She also discusses her bills for the session including specific funding for projects in her district and priorities for helping build more housing stock and reminding homelessness. Finally, we discuss her role as Chair of the Assembly Arts Committee and the opening up of venues across her district and California.
